The Guardian - Opinion - Trump is trying to make a comeback. It’s not working.

 

21 Jan 2024

 


Once again, the legal pitfalls and enthusiasm deficit that plague Donald Trump’s bid for the 2024 Republican nomination are on display. 

 

On Thursday, a federal judge imposed $938,000 in sanctions on Trump and his lawyers. 

 

Meanwhile, an appearance touted by Trump as a major campaign event was nothing more than a closed-door speech to deep-pocketed election-deniers at a Trump property.

 

For those looking for uplift from a Trump campaign, those days are over. 

 

Rather, personal grievance and claims of a stolen 2020 election will likely be his dominant themes. 

 

For the 45th president, that may bring catharsis.

 

For everyone else in the Republican party, that spells chaos, headache and the possibility of another Trump defeat at the hands of Joe Biden and the Democrats.

The Guardian - Trump’s golf course photo with Philadelphia mob boss raises questions

 

23 Jan 2023

 



 

 Merlino was convicted on racketeering charges in 2001, and spent a decade in prison.

 

He was imprisoned again in 2018, after pleading guilty to a gambling charge, then released in 2020.

 


Speaking to CBS in 2013, Trump was asked if he had “ever knowingly done business with organised crime”.

 

He said: “You know, growing up in New York and doing business in New York, I would say there might have been one of those characters along the way, but generally speaking I like to stay away from that group.

 

“I have met on occasion a few of those people. They happen to be very nice people.

 

He added: “You just don’t want to owe them money. Don’t owe them money.”
